The King is Back - Preston Dean Crowned Champion of the Record-Breaking RPT Casino State Championship
The Roughrider Poker Tour Casino State Championship at Spirit Lake Casino & Resort turned into an event North Dakota had never seen before. The $250 Main Event attracted a massive 1,655 entries, inflating the prizepool to $331,000, making it the largest poker event in the state's history.

WSOP Circuit Kicks Off Another Year in Rozvadov, First Three Rings Awarded
As a new season begins, poker enthusiasts from all over Europe traditionally gather at the Czech-German border. The WSOP Circuit at King's Resort Rozvadov has launched the year 2026, with 12 gold rings up for grabs until January 13th.
